20 March 1897

At single anchor off Salala.  Wind SW force 2 with broken cloud. Barometer 30.05 inches falling to 29.98 at 1600 and finishing at 30.05 at midnight. Temperature at noon 81F. 0400. Raised steam in number 4 boiler. (????) spring port side  (???) cable (Unable to read handwriting) 0559. Sunrise S89 ½ E. Turkish flags hauled down astern. Muscat flag hoisted. 0630. Weighed. Shifted berth. Engines as requisite. 0640. Came to on broken bottom in 6 fathoms with spring on cable – 2 ½ shackles. Veered to 3 ½ shackles. 1200. Employed as requisite. Distilling.  Anchor bearings Raskkan S56W. Tower N27W. 1700. Quarters. Coal expended not logged. Number on sick list 2.
